I wonder how soon they'll have their end of season reviews. That time between the final and the draft seems a little rushed compared to the men. But I guess that tracks - shorter season, shorter shrift.

From the list at the start of the season, there's 20 players who I can't see us moving on. I'd have the following players as possibilities not to be on the list next year, purely based on circumstance, hints in the media and/or games played (or not played) this year.

  • Caitlin Wendland - Got her chance but struggled to adapt to the pace of the game. A late convert to the game, so might get another shot and was an emergency for the GF.
  • Kate Lutkins - Only included here because of her age (will be 36 by the time the season starts next year) and the recent maternity break. She won't get pushed, if she goes it will be her call I'd assume.
  • Bella Smith - First year back after an ACL and broke through for a game in R9. Also listed as an emergency for all of the finals.
  • Luka Yoshida-Martin - Haven't been sold on her appearances so far. But with Miki and Zimmie possibly moving on there may still be a spot for her. Was rumoured to be close to a move last year, but haven't heard anything in that regard so far this year.
  • Brooke Sheridan - Was a top-up to replace Luka. Don't think she made the emergencies once this year, so would be long odds to stay on, although is only 18yo.
  • Zimmorlei Farquharson - strongly rumoured to be on the move to Footscray
  • Dee Heslop - Played plenty of games before her suspension and appears to do her role, but isn't exactly a damaging player. Does appear to have the favour of the coaches and given the propensity to shift the skipper into the midfield on occasion, would probably be pretty safe.
  • Jade Pregelj - Was probably signed purely as a backup for Lutsy, so it might depend on what happens there. The emergence of Boltz and Dunne late in the season make it a bit more unlikely.
  • Ella Smith - Played one game early on, then named emergency a few time before failing down the pecking order a little. Copped a groin injury which kept he out for most of the second half of the season.
  • Mikayla Pauga - Struggled earlier in the season before forcing her way into the side late. Recent rumours of a potential move to Western Sydney
  • Courtney Murphy - Unsighted, but the only pure ruck on the list. I've no idea how her transition back to footy is going. We may find out soon.
  • Kiara Hillier - Two year on the list with no games doesn't bode well, although was named emergency a few times.
  • Analea McKee - Will probably go around again given the lack of tall forwards and rucks on the list.

Very hard for an outsider to make any calls based on reserves form or their general professionalism. But if I was to guess, I'd have the following outs: Sheridan, Farquharson, Pregelj, Pauga, Hillier.

Some names out of our Academy to keep an eye on for the draft in a few weeks time:

  • Sophie Peters (Maroochydore) - outside mid/wing
  • Evie Long* (Sandgate) - hybrid forward
  • Rania Crozier (Aspley) - tall forward
  • Lilu Hung* (Wilston Grange/Aspley) - tall forward
( marked * = nominated nationally)

Other names to look out for, especially at our first pick (based on nothing more than they've nominated nationally and could be a good fit:
  • Brooke Barwick (Tasmania) - inside mid
  • Georgia Clark (Tasmania) - tall forward
  • Cleo Buttifant (Giants Academy) - tall defender
  • Ella Slocombe (Claremont) - general mid
  • Kristie-Lee Weston-Turner (Western Jets) - tall forward
It will be interesting to see what approach they take with the pick 12. You would have to think you go best available. Might also depend on whether we still have a nudge wink agreement with the Suns not to poach each other's Academy players, assuming they nominate the Queensland zone.

Also, keep an ear out for Tshinta Kendall who is a mature-age rugby 7's convert who I believe was playing as a top-up for our reserves this year at times.

The list of players who've not nominated a particular state is quite large this year. We'd silly not to consider a good interstate talent. For the first time, I think live bidding will occur on academy girls, so the days of getting bargain at the back end of the draft is over. Our highest ranked girl Sophie Peters has nominated Qld, so can't be drafted by any other club (aside from Gold Coast) which means it's likely we'll have a free shot at #12..
